Scientific Results Cometary observations Program to observe (short period) comets at large heliocentric distance (imaging, spectroscopy) for studying onset of activity Several observation runs performed at various national and international telescopes Akari (ASTRO-F) program accepted (P.I.: Elena Mazzotta Epifani) E. Epifani et al., The dust coma of the active Centaur P/2004 A1 (LONEOS): a CO-driven environment, Astronomy and Astrophysics, accepted (2006)
Scientific Results Stardust sample analysis (P.I.: Alessandra Rotundi) Laboratories in Naples and Catania Morphology (FESEM), Composition (EDX), m-Raman and m-Infrared spectroscopy Several 10-20 mm particles analysed Papers in preparation Wrap up meeting in November
